1. A college graduate is trying to decide whether to pursue a master's degree or not. He will only do so if he is convinced that master's degree loan more than college graduates. He experimented in 20 master's degree holders and 25 college graduates. The yearly salaries were P170, 000 and P126, 000 respectively with corresponding standard deviations of P6, 000 and P5, 400. Using 0.10 significance level, test if there is a significant difference in the amount of loan that a master's degree holder and a college graduates could avail.
